MMDA: No number coding in Metro Manila today, Feb. 25

(Eagle News)–The number-coding scheme in Metro Manila is suspended today, Monday, Feb. 25. The Metropolitan Manila Development Authority made the announcement in a Tweet on the same day. The MMDA said the suspension was to give way to celebrations for the People Power anniversary. In line with this, the MMDA said the lane on Edsa in front of the People Power monument will be closed from 6 a.m. to 10 a.m. today.

Makati Prosecutors Office junks Kris Aquino’s qualified theft complaint vs former project manager

(Eagle News) — The Makati Prosecutors Office has dismissed the qualified theft complaint filed by Kris Aquino against her former project manager. In dismissing the complaint, the prosecutors office ruled any personal transaction Nicko Falcis made with the credit card Aquino said was the card of her company Kris Cojuangco Aquino Productions did not constitute theft. DOTr warns public against “name-dropping” individuals who solicit money

(Eagle News)–The Department of Transportation has warned the public against unscrupulous individuals who use the names of the agency’s officials and former officials in corrupt activities. The DOTr issued the statement after it received a letter from its former undersecretary Tim Orbos saying that certain individuals were using his name to solicit money from others who wish to expedite their applications in line with the government’s public utility vehicle modernization program.
